From being bemused by … WebMay 30, 2024 · How to solve a crime with genetic genealogy Crime enforcement agency (police department, sheriff’s office) contracts a DNA investigation company to help them crack a cold case. The company analyses crime scene DNA and converts it into a file representing its unique sequence of bases (adenine, cytosine, guanine, and thymine).

WebNov 20, 2024 · The most frequently solved violent crime tends to be homicide. Police cleared around six-in-ten murders and non-negligent manslaughters (61.4%) last year.
